Can you use Dawn to clean vinyl siding?

Dish soap or laundry soap mixed with warm water are efficient at cleaning your siding. … You can use a handheld spray bottle to apply your dish soap mixture. Using a wet soft-bristled brush, start from the bottom of your section and scrub from side to side.

How do you clean vinyl siding without a pressure washer?

Use a bleach cleaning solution. Mix a third of a cup (78 Milliliters) of powdered laundry detergent, two thirds of a cup (157 Milliliters) of powdered household cleaner, and one quart (946 Milliliters) of laundry bleach in one gallon (3.78 L) of water. You can also use a bleach solution to clean mold from vinyl siding.

When should you clean vinyl siding?

After the solutions are applied and the house rinsed, your siding should look like new again. We recommend cleaning your siding once a year to avoid build up and keep it looking its best.
